Acid attack survivor reaches out to Shah Rukh Khan after being denied a bank account

An acid attack survivor was denied the basic right of having a new bank account because she couldn't blink after a KYC machine could not scan her biometric details. To raise awareness around this issue and get justice, Pragya Prasun reached out to Shah Rukh Khan and his NGO Meer Foundation. 

Meer Foundation focuses on the rehabilitation of acid attack survivors under the work for women empowerment and funds corrective surgeries. It is named after Shah Rukh Khan's father Meer Taj Mohammed Khan.

Akshay Kumar, Pankaj Tripathi-starrer OMG 2's release stopped by Censor Board

It has been reported that Akshay Kumar, Pankaj Tripathi-starrer OMG 2 has landed in a controversy. As per multiple media reports, the second instalment of the much-awaited comedy-satire has facing trouble with the Central Board of Certification (CBFC). Some reports claim that the CBFC has stopped the film's release while others claim that the board has asked the makers to take the film to the Revision Committee. The film is slated to be released in theatres on August 11.

72 Hoorain box office collection: Ashoke Pandit's controversial film falls flat

Helmed by National-award winning filmmaker Sanjay Puran Singh Chauhan, '72 Hoorain' courted several controversies even before its release. The film stars Pavan Malhotra and Ameer Bashir in lead roles. It was accused of 'hurting religious sentiments of a community', hence, the film was released without a trailer. A police complaint was even filed against the makers. Unlike 'The Kerala Story', this kind of controversy failed to hype up '72 Hoorain' as it is hardly minting anything at the box office. In three days, the film barely managed to collect Rs 1 crore.

'Bahattar Hoorain (72 Hoorain)' finally released in theatres on July 7 without a trailer. The film starring Pawan Malhotra and Aamir Bashir received mixed reviews and opened to multiple controversies.
